The government has fleshed out its plans for reforming the UK pension industry, including the creation of £25bn "megafunds" which will be instructed to make a portion of their investments locally to help fuel economic growth.

The chancellor said the overhaul, designed to follow the example of Australia and Canada's huge pension investment funds, would also boost people's pension pots.

"These reforms mean better returns for workers and billions more invested in clean energy and highgrowth businesses," Rachel Reeves said.

Seventeen of the UK's largest pension firms already approved the gist of these reforms in a voluntary agreement earlier this month.

However, the government is also including a legislative back-stop, which will allow it to push through the new rules, if insufficient progress

is made by the end of the decade.The government has indicated it does not expect to use the new powers. Nevertheless, that element may draw criticism, with some in the industry opposed to any government mandate over how and where investments are made.

"The challenge for investment into the UK has been finding

good investments to makeand policy that may improve that supply side [is] probably just as important," Chris Rule, chief executive of the Local Pensions Partnership, told BBC Radio 4's Today programme. He added that most pension funds "invest in the UK and locally anyway".

Zoe Alexander, a director at

the Pensions and Lifetime Savings Association, said the changes would have "significant implications" for how pension schemes operated.But she added: "Increased consolidation has the potential to improve retirement outcomes through improved governance, wider investment diversification and improved bargaining

power."

Miles Celic, chief executive of The City UK, representing the financial services industry, backed the chancellor's assertion that the move could "help drive economic growth".

A former Liberal Democrat pensions minister, Sir Steve Webb, who is now a partner at consultants LCP, described the news as "truly a red letter day for pension schemes, their members and the companies who stand behind them".

"The government has clearly been bold in this area and this opens up the potential for this surplus money to be used more productively to benefit scheme members, firms and the wider economy," he added. One of Labour's first moves after taking office last year was the announcement of a pension review. In November the chancellor floated her "megafunds" plan, which covers retirement savings for the majority of UK workers in two ways.

A nine-year-old was the youngest victim injured when a car was driven into crowds at Liverpool's victory parade, police said, as they continue to question a suspect.

Merseyside Police confirmed the age of the victims hurt in the incident on Water Street on Monday ranged from nine to 78.

The force has until Thursday evening to question a 53-year-old man, from West Derby, Liverpool, who is in custody after he was arrested on suspicion of attempted murder, dangerous driving and drug driving.

On Wednesday, police said seven people remained in hospital in a stable condition, while 79 people in total had been injured when the car crashed into Liverpool fans.

Drinking water shortage in decade without new reservoirs, minister says

England could face drinking water shortages within a decade unless new reservoirs are built, a minister has claimed.

The warning comes as the government announced it was speeding up the planning process for two reservoir projects.

But overriding local objections can be unpopular and the reservoirs could still be more than a decade away from opening.

Household consumption of water may also need to fall to secure supplies amid rising temperatures and a growing population, scientists warn.

The announcement means that final decisions about the proposed Fens Reservoir in Cambridgeshire and the Lincolnshire Reservoir will be taken by Environment Secretary Steve Reed, rather than at a local level.

This change amounts to "slashing red tape to make the planning process faster", according to Water Minister Emma Hardy.

Speaking to BBC Breakfast, she said: "This is really important because if we don't build the reservoirs, we're going to be running out of the drinking water that we need by the mid-2030s."

The reservoirs in Cambridgeshire and Lincolnshire are currently

pencilled for completion in 2036 and 2040 respectively. They "would provide more resilience to future droughts in a part of the country that is already dry and where there is high demand for water", said Dr Glenn Watts, water science director at the UK Centre for Ecology & Hydrology. Reservoirs can help protect against the impacts of drought by collecting excess rainfall during wet periods.

With climate change likely to bring hotter, drier summers,

the chances of drought could increase in the decades ahead, the Met Office says. These preparations have been brought into sharp focus by this year's exceptionally dry spring. North-west England is officially in drought, according to the Environment Agency, which says it is watching the situation closely in other regions. Extra demand from new houses, data centres and other sectors could further squeeze supplies, but no major reservoirs have been

completed in England since 1992, shortly after the water sector was privatised.

Last year the government and water companies announced proposals to build nine new reservoirs by 2050. Together they have the potential to provide 670 million litres of extra water per day, they say.

That's in addition to the Havant Thicket reservoir project in Hampshire, which is already under way and is expected to be completed by 2031.

The government also says that

it intends to pass legislation to automatically make the other seven proposed reservoirs "nationally significant", so the final decision would be taken by national government.

"Reservoir projects are very complex infrastructure projects that are slow to take forward, and so anything that can be done to streamline that process can be a positive thing," said David Porter, senior vice president of the Institution of Civil Engineers (ICE). The water industry has also welcomed the announcement.

"It's absolutely critical that we build these reservoirs now," David Henderson, chief executive of Water UK, told BBC News.

"If we don't build them now, we wait another 10 years, it's going to cost even more, so we can't keep kicking the can down the road any longer." But building reservoirs doesn't come cheaply, even with accelerated planning processes. That could ultimately filter down to people's bills. Nor does it come quickly. No new major reservoirs are due to be completed this decade. Some experts highlight that reservoirs are no silver bullet, and warn that managing how we use water needs to take greater precedence in a warming climate.

China backs Starmer’s Chagos deal

Desk report:

The Chinese government has welcomed Sir Keir Starmer’s Chagos Islands deal as a “massive achievement”, despite his claim that Beijing had opposed it.

Beijing’s ambassador to Mauritius talked up the deal in a speech on Tuesday, after Sir Keir signed away the Chagos Islands and agreed to pay Mauritius £30 billion over 99 years. Huang Shifang told guests at the Chinese embassy that her government offered “massive congratulations” on the deal, and that China “fully supports” Mauritius’s attempt to “safeguard national sovereignty”. She also confirmed that Mauritius would soon join Beijing’s Belt and Road initiative, despite claims from the UK Government that the East African island nation was not under Chinese influence. The relationship between Mauritius and China has been a point of contention for Sir Keir, who faced accusations he was giving away British territory to an ally of one of the UK’s enemies.

The Chagos Islands, known in the UK as the British Indian Ocean Territory, host the

Diego Garcia military base which is jointly used by British and US forces. Under the terms of the Prime Minister’s deal announced last week, the UK will pay billions of pounds to rent back the military base after sovereignty of the islands has been transferred to Mauritius. The Government argues that the deal creates legal security for the base, which was

under threat from a territorial dispute from Mauritius in the international courts.

Addressing his critics, Sir Keir told a press conference that Conservative and Reform opponents of the deal were in a “column” with Russia, China and Iran, who he said had all opposed it.

“In favour are all of our allies: the US, Nato, Five Eyes, India,” he said.

“Against it: Russia, China, Iran. Surprisingly, the leader of the Opposition and Nigel Farage are in that column alongside Russia, China and Iran, rather than the column that has the UK and its allies in it.” But that argument was contradicted by the Chinese government five days later, when their ambassador welcomed the deal.

According to the local newspaper Le Mauricien, Ms Huang told party guests on Tuesday that China offered “massive congratulations” to Mauritius for securing the disputed territory with the UK. Dame Priti Patel, the shadow foreign secretary, told The Telegraph: “Once again, Keir Starmer has been caught peddling a lie.

“He claimed that those who opposed his mad plan to surrender the Chagos Islands were in league with hostile powers – whilst himself handing over control of our own sovereign territory to a nation firmly in China’s grasp.

“And now China itself has welcomed the deal – knowing that Labour weakening our national security is at their benefit – Keir Starmer must apologise, and retract his baseless slander.” A Mauritian government statement said that the Chinese ambassador pointed to “Mauritius’s firm adherence to the One-China policy”, the political doctrine that Taiwan is part of China, and drew comparison between China’s dispute with Taiwan and Mauritius’s dispute with the UK.

Uninterrupted journey of democracy

still being hindered: Khaleda

Desk report::

BNP Chairperson Khaleda Zia has said though the party founder late president Ziaur Rahman embraced martyrdom in the fight to establish democracy and safeguard sovereignty, the uninterrupted journey of democracy is still being hindered at every turn.

She hoped that democracy would be restored in the country very soon and urged the party leaders and activists to maintain discipline for the cause.

The BNP chief was addressing a party programme on Thursday held at the Institution of Engineers, Bangladesh auditorium in Dhaka, marking the 44th martyrdom anniversary of Ziaur Rahman, who was assassinated by a group of disgruntled army officers on 30 May 1981 at Chattogram Circuit House.

Khaleda Zia said, “Every year, this day brings sorrowful memories to our family. On this day, not only our family but also the entire nation was plunged into grief and left without a guardian.”

She said, “The name of Shaheed President Ziaur Rahman is inseparably connected to our beloved motherland, Bangladesh.”

He (Zia) declared the country’s independence from Chattogram, forever linking his name with the nation, she said, adding that it was in the same district, he sacrificed his life as a successful, honest, visionary, and truly patriotic president.

The BNP chairperson said, “Shaheed Zia is the unparalleled architect of democracy, independence, freedom of the press, judicial independence, selfreliance, development, and the creation of distinct nationalism in this country.

“He embraced martyrdom in the fight to establish democracy and safeguard sovereignty, but the uninterrupted journey of that democracy still faces obstacles at every step.”

She added, “Very soon, we will witness the reestablishment of

Japan to recruit one lakh Bangladeshi workers in five years

Desk report:: Japanese authorities and businesses on Thursday announced plans to recruit at least 100,000 workers from Bangladesh in the next five years to meet the country's growing workers' shortage.

Speaking at a seminar titled, “Bangladesh Seminar on Human Resources”, Chief Adviser Professor Muhammad Yunus said that his interim government would do everything in its capacity to create the job opportunities for Bangladeshis in Japan.

“This is going to be the most exciting day for me, the most inspiring day. This will open the door for Bangladeshis to not only work but to know Japan,” said the chief adviser.

The chief adviser witnessed the signing of two Memorandum of Understanding – first between Bangladesh's Bureau of Manpower Employment and Training (BMET) and Kaicom Dream Street (KDS), a JapanBangladesh joint venture,

and second between Bangladesh's BMET and Japan’s National Business Support Combined Cooperatives (a business federation with over 65 receiving companies operating in Japan) and JBBRA (Japan Bangla Bridge Recruiting Agency) at the event organised in Toshi Kaikan conference hall.

“This gathering is about opening the door,” said Prof Yunus, noting that

Bangladesh is a country of 180 million people, and half of them are under 27.

“The government’s job is to open the door for them,” he said.

Mitsuru Matsushita, representative director of Supervising Organisation Shizuoka Workplace Environment Improvement Cooperative said many Japanese companies are facing enquiries about Bangladeshis, and he believed this trend would continue.

“Bangladeshi talents hold great potential. It is our duty to nurture their talent,” he said.

Mikio Kesagayama, chairman of NBCC, recalled that about 14 years ago, Professor Yunus came to Japan and was telling stories about helping women through microcredit.

He said that in the first three decades of their business, they strived for a quality workforce.

“Our Federation looks to Bangladesh for young and capable labour. They can contribute to the development of both Bangladesh and Japan,” he said.

“In the coming five years, we are prepared to welcome more than 100,000 Bangladeshi workers,” he said.

Sharing the future plan on the recruitment of Bangladeshis in the Japanese industries, Miki Watanabe, president of Watami Group, said that a school they established in Bangladesh trains 1,500 students every year, and they are now planning to raise the number to 3,000.

With technical education in Bangladesh, they can enter the job market in Japan, he said.

Hiroaki Yagi, Japan International Trainee & Skilled Worker Cooperation Organisation (JITCO) chairman, shared the potential and challenges for Bangladeshis in the Japanese labour market.

He said the number of language teachers in Bangladesh is still short.

Niki Hirobumi, state minister of the Ministry of Health, Labour and Welfare (MHLW), Japan, said Japan is facing a declining population and thus will need the support of Bangladeshi workforce.

“This can be promising not only for Bangladesh but also for Japan,” he said.

In his welcome speech, Daud Ali, ambassador of Bangladesh to Japan, said by 2040, the Japanese labour shortage could reach 11 million, and Bangladesh could take this opportunity to send more skilled workers.

Some Japanese companies have already recruited Bangladeshi workers to address their labour shortages, and interest continues to grow,” said the Ambassador.

Representatives from several Japanese companies that have already hired Bangladeshi workers also spoke at the event. They praised the competence, sincerity, and professionalism of Bangladeshi employees.

The company officials expressed their eagerness to recruit more workers from Bangladesh and emphasised the importance of both governments taking the necessary steps to facilitate the process.

Foreign Adviser Md Touhid Hossain, Chief Adviser’s Special Assistant Lutfey Siddiqi, and Principal Coordinator on SDG Affairs Lamiya Morshed were, among others, present at the programme Prof Yunus arrived in the Japanese capital, Tokyo, on Wednesday on a 4-day visit to attend the 30th Nikkei Forum: Future of Asia and to hold bilateral talks with Japanese Prime Minister Shigeru Ishiba.
